About Us:

Kingston State College has been a cornerstone of education in the Kingston and Logan communities. Our College spans two vibrant campuses: a Years 7– 12 State High School and the Kingston Learning College, a highly respected Re- Engagement Centre. The Learning College operates on a flexible quarterly enrolment model, supporting students in Years 9–12 to complete academic subjects and vocational education pathways that lead to meaningful future opportunities.

About the Role:

Responsibilities include, but not limited to;

  • Support the Principal to provide strategic leadership for the Special Education Program (SEP) or Early Childhood Development Program (ECDP), including developing and implementing a shared vision that delivers high-quality learning outcomes for all students, and deputising when required.
  • Lead an inclusive and values-based culture by embedding socially just practices, maintaining high expectations for student achievement and staff performance, and promoting ethical, equitable, and inclusive leadership.
  • Manage and develop the program through effective leadership of human, financial, curriculum, and physical resources to ensure high-quality educational programs and successful outcomes for students with disability and diverse learning needs.
  • Build collaborative partnerships with families, students, government agencies, community organisations, industry, and external service providers to enhance student learning, wellbeing, and successful transitions.
  • Demonstrate professional and strategic leadership by engaging in ongoing professional learning, maintaining a strong understanding of legislation and policies relating to inclusive education and students with disability, and driving continuous improvement through future-focused planning.
